B.S. in Applied Physics<\/a><\/strong>, the B.A. provides a more flexible curriculum while maintaining a strong foundation in physics.<\/p>\n\n\n\nPhysics is a vast discipline which studies the entire realm of nature from the utmost minute particles, distances and times imaginable to the most massive stars and the outer limits of the universe. From a more applied perspective, physics is used to solve practical problems, often to advance technology to positively impact humanity. Physicists observe the phenomena of nature and try to find patterns that relate these phenomena. Physics is particularly concerned with those aspects of nature which can be formulated in terms of principles and laws expressed in an elegant and concise mathematical form. <\/p>\n\n\n\n
